Eleven persons of the minority community were killed in the violence at Naroda Gam here during the 2002 post-Godhra riots. Former Gujarat minister Mayaben Kodnani is one of the 79 accused in the case.
The case was probed by the Supreme Court-appointed special investigation team.
P L Mall, the investigating officer, deposed before special court judge P B Desai over the last 22 months.
Mall, now the Superintendent of Police in Sabarkantha district, was the 187th witness to depose. The trial started in 2009.
It was Mall, the then Deputy SP with SIT, who had arrested Kodnani in 2009. Kodnani has been sentenced to a 28-year jail term in the Naroda Patiya riot case.
